Obituary

Caeser L. Jones, 67, passed away on Sunday, March 12, 2023 from a prolonged illness. 

Caeser was born March 2, 1956 in South Bend, IN to Joseph D. and Vivian Jones.  He attended Harrison Grade and Washington High School, where he was a decorated athlete in basketball and baseball.

Upon graduating from High School, Caeser worked for years at Solvay - Mann Hummel and Honeywell factories. He retired from Honeywell in 2018 due to a sudden illness. Caeser was a member of St. Luke’s Memorial Church of God in Christ. What Caeser enjoyed most in life was spending time with his family and friends at backyard barbecues, watching football and basketball games and mowing not only his, but other family members lawn.  

Caeser is survived by the love of his life, daughter, Cierra R. Jones. He always did and wanted what was best for her.  She in return was by his side throughout his illness and to the very end.  He is also survived by sisters, Sister Marcella Jones (Pastor Fred) Preston, Arena M. Jones, Cynthia C. (Freddie) Mcknight and Katherine L. Jones.  Brothers, Larry J. Jones and Lawrence B. Jones.  Special friend, Ronetta Hernton (Cierra’s mother), who was also at his side until the very end.  Brenda Blake and Debra Carothers, who provided support and friendship throughout Caeser’s illness.  Nephew, Cedric R. Moodie Jr., who throughout Caeser’s illness, helped physical take care of him.  Special cousins, Rose Hudson and Effie Clay-White. There are also a host of nieces, nephews, cousins and friends that will miss and cherish his memories. 

Caeser was preceded in death by his parents, Joseph D. and Vivian Jones-Gray, Stepfather, Levi Gray, Brother, John E. Coleman, Sister, Marcia M. Jones, Niece, Tanya M. Jones and Nephew, Joseph D. White.

Although, it’s so hard to say goodbye, rest in peace Caeser.  The pain of your leaving is unbearable.  We will never stop loving and missing you.  Daddy, mama, Levi, Marie, Tanya and JD (Joker) welcome you with loving arms. 

Homegoing services for Brother Jones will be held on Monday March 20, 2023; 11 A.M at Pentecostal Cathedral Church Of God In Christ, 1025 Western Ave. South Bend, Indiana 46601. Friends may visit with the family an hour prior. Burial will follow at Riverview Cemetery. Arrangements have been entrusted with Alford's Mortuary Inc.
